‘Burlesque: Heart of the Glitter Tribe’ Peeks Behind The Curtain Of A Modern Movement

February 28, 2017 by James Jay Edwards

Documentaries about subcultures are usually fun because they give the viewer a glimpse into a world that they might otherwise have never even known existed.  The new film from Jon Manning, Burlesque: Heart of the Glitter Tribe does just that, and does it in a way that is both informative and entertaining.
